TECHNICAL FIELD
[0001] The present application belongs to the technical field of pharmaceutical preparation, and particularly relates to a preparation process of effervescent granules containing a composition of phenylephrine hydrochloride. BACKGROUND
[0002] Respiratory diseases include a variety of diseases, which are mostly caused by viruses or bacteria, such as cold and flu, and allergic rhinitis, etc. The main symptoms are fever, nasal congestion, runny nose, cough, sneezing or headache. If not treated in time, many complications can be caused, which seriously harm people's health.
[0003] There are many solid preparations containing phenylephrine hydrochloride for treating cold, and the dosage forms are various, such as tablets, capsules, granules, etc. As known by those skilled in the art, when preparing suitable products, the first problem to be considered is the stability of the drug and the release rate of the drug. Therefore, the selection of the dosage form and the setting of the process parameters are challenging work. If the prescription is unreasonable or the selection of the excipients and the process conditions are not considered during preparation, the active ingredients in the drug can be degraded, which can reduce the therapeutic effect and cause side effects. [0005] The preparation process of the effervescent granules containing a composition of phenylephrine hydrochloride is prepared by using alpha adrenergic receptor agonist phenylephrine hydrochloride as the main active ingredient, and combining with antiallergic drugs, expectorants, antitussives, antipyretics, anti-inflammatory agents and their combinations. In order to prevent the degradation of phenylephrine hydrochloride, the phenylephrine hydrochloride is first coated with PEG and then mixed with other ingredients to prepare the effervescent granules. Through scientific analysis methods such as orthogonal test, the present application has prepared the drug with stability, rapid effect, high bioavailability, convenient carrying and low cost, which is suitable for children, the elderly and patients who cannot swallow solid preparations.

[0010] To prepare effervescent granules, the specific embodiments of the present application are as follows:
[0011] The preparation process of the effervescent granules containing the phenylephrine hydrochloride composition includes the following components and proportions:
[0012] Drug or excipient name Amount (%) Drug or excipient name Amount (%) Acetaminophen 1-5 Binder 1-10 Chlorpheniramine maleate 0-0.05 Filling agent 30-65 Dextromethorphan hydrobromide 0-0.05 Coating agent (lubricant) 1-5 Phenylephrine hydrochloride 0-0.1 Flavor 0-0.5 Acid source 10-25 Flavoring agent 0.5-5 Antioxidant 1-8 Colorant 0.1-0.5 Base source 10-20 Solvent q.s.
[0013] The preparation process of the effervescent granules containing the phenylephrine hydrochloride composition can also include the following components and proportions:
[0014] Drug or excipient name Amount (%) Drug or excipient name Amount (%) Acetaminophen 1-5 Binder 1-13 Chlorpheniramine maleate 0-0.05 Filling agent 30-60 Dextromethorphan hydrobromide 0-0.05 Coating agent (lubricant) 1-5 Phenylephrine hydrochloride 0-0.1 Flavor 0-0.4 Acid source 10-20 Flavoring agent 0.5-3 Antioxidant 1-8 Colorant 0.1-0.4 Base source 10-15 Solvent q.s.
[0015] The preparation process of the effervescent granules containing the phenylephrine hydrochloride composition can also include the following components and proportions:
[0016] Drug or excipient name Amount (%) Drug or excipient name Amount (%) Acetaminophen 1-5 Binder 5-13 Chlorpheniramine maleate 0-0.05 Filling agent 30-55 Dextromethorphan hydrobromide 0-0.05 Coating agent (lubricant) 1-4 Phenylephrine hydrochloride 0-0.1 Flavor 0-0.3 Acid source 15-20 Flavoring agent 1-3 Antioxidant 1-8 Colorant 0.1-0.3 Base source 12-15 Solvent q.s.
[0017] The acid source includes but is not limited to one or more of the following: citric acid, tartaric acid, fumaric acid, adipic acid, malic acid.
[0018] The alkali source includes but is not limited to one or more of the following: sodium carbonate, sodium bicarbonate, potassium carbonate, potassium bicarbonate, calcium carbonate.
[0019] The coating agent (which can also be used as a lubricant) includes but is not limited to one or more of the following: PEG4000 or PEG6000.
[0020] The filler includes but is not limited to one or more of the following: lactose, mannitol, sucrose, glucose.
[0021] The binder includes but is not limited to one or more of the following: PVP, ethanol, carboxymethyl cellulose, povidone K30.
[0022] The flavoring agent includes but is not limited to one or more of the following: peppermint oil, menthol, stevioside, sucralose.
[0023] The essence includes but is not limited to one or more of the following: sweet orange essence, lemon essence, orange essence, apple essence, pineapple essence.
[0024] The pigment includes but is not limited to one or more of the following: brilliant blue, orange yellow, orange red.
[0025] The antioxidant includes but is not limited to one or more of the following: vitamin C, sodium metabisulfite, propyl gallate.
[0026] The preparation process of the effervescent granules containing the phenylephrine hydrochloride composition,
[0027] The solvent includes purified water, deionized water, distilled water.
[0028] The preparation process is as follows:
[0029] 1. Raw material processing:
[0030] 1.1 The paracetamol is crushed and passed through a 150-200 mesh sieve to obtain paracetamol fine powder for use;
[0031] 1.2 The coating agent (which can also be used as a lubricant) is crushed and passed through a 150-160 mesh sieve to obtain coating agent fine powder for use;
[0032] 1.3 The binder is mixed with a certain amount of solvent to prepare a solution, and the binder solution is obtained for use;
[0033] 2. Preparation of acidic granules:
[0034] 2.1 The paracetamol fine powder, chlorpheniramine maleate, dextromethorphan hydrobromide are mixed uniformly to obtain a raw material mixture for use;
[0035] 2.2 The antioxidant, filler, and flavoring agent are mixed uniformly to obtain an auxiliary material mixture for use;
[0036] 2.3 The raw material mixture, auxiliary material mixture, and acid source are mixed uniformly, and the binder solution is added to prepare a soft material, granulated, dried, and sieved to obtain acid granules for use;
[0037] 3. Preparation of base granules:
[0038] 3.1 The coating agent is heated and dissolved at 60-70°C, and then the epinephrine hydrochloride and the base source are added and stirred uniformly, and then cooled, crushed, and sieved to obtain a base source coating;
[0039] 3.2 The base source coating is subjected to dry granulation, sieved, and obtained as base granules for use;
[0040] 4. Under the conditions of a temperature of 18-26°C and a humidity of less than 60%, a small amount of acid granules is added with an equal amount of increasing colorant and flavoring agent, and then the remaining acid granules and base granules are added and mixed uniformly, and then packaged to obtain the product.
[0041] The granulation refers to granulation with a swing granulator, and the granulation mesh size is 18-30 mesh;
[0042] The drying refers to drying under reduced pressure or hot air circulation drying at a temperature not higher than 60°C;
[0043] The granulation refers to granulation with a swing granulator, and the granulation mesh size is 18-30 mesh;
[0044] The sieving refers to sieving out the particles that do not pass through the first sieve, and then sieving out the particles that pass through the fifth sieve from the particles that pass through the first sieve, and taking the particles that pass through the first sieve but cannot pass through the fifth sieve.

[0050] Example 1
[0051] Composition and ratio:
[0052] Drug or excipient name Amount (%) Drug or excipient name Amount (%) Acetaminophen 3.25 PVP 3 Chlorpheniramine maleate 0.02 Lactose 55 Dextromethorphan hydrobromide 0.01 PEG 6000 4.0 Phenylephrine hydrochloride 0.05 Orange flavor 0.37 Tartaric acid 18.0 Stevioside 1.0 Sodium metabisulfite 3.2 Brilliant blue 0.1 Sodium bicarbonate 12.0 Purified water q.s.
[0053] The preparation process is as follows:
[0054] 1. Raw material treatment:
[0055] 1.1 The acetaminophen is crushed and passed through a 150-mesh sieve to obtain acetaminophen fine powder for standby;
[0056] 1.2 The PEG6000 is crushed and passed through a 150-mesh sieve to obtain wrapping agent fine powder for standby;
[0057] 1.3 The PVP is added with a certain amount of purified water to prepare a solution to obtain a binder aqueous solution for standby
[0058] 2. Preparation of acidic granules:
[0059] 2.1 The acetaminophen fine powder, chlorpheniramine maleate and dextromethorphan hydrobromide are mixed uniformly to obtain a raw material mixture for standby;
[0060] 2.2 The sodium pyrosulfite, lactose and stevioside are mixed uniformly to obtain an auxiliary material mixture for standby;
[0061] 2.3 Mix the raw material mixture, the auxiliary material mixture and the acid source uniformly, add the adhesive aqueous solution to make a soft material, granulate with a 24-mesh screen, dry at 55°C under reduced pressure, size with a 24-mesh screen, sieve, obtain the acid granules, and reserve;
[0062] 3. Preparation of the base granules:
[0063] 3.1 After the PEG6000 is heated and dissolved at 60-70°C, add the phenylephrine hydrochloride and the sodium bicarbonate, stir uniformly, cool, crush, sieve with a 100-mesh screen, obtain the base source coating, and reserve;
[0064] 3.2 Dry granulate the base source coating, size with a 24-mesh screen, sieve, obtain the base granules, and reserve;
[0065] 4. Under the conditions of a temperature of 18-26°C and a humidity of below 60%, take a small amount of the acid granules, add the brilliant blue and the orange flavor in equal increments respectively, mix uniformly, then add the remaining acid granules and the base granules in sequence and continue to mix uniformly, package, and obtain the product.

[0102] Example 5
[0103] The content of phenylephrine hydrochloride is taken as the detection object, and the stability of the effervescent granules prepared in Examples 1 to 3 is investigated.
[0104] Method:
[0105] 10g of the suspension prepared in Examples 1 to 3 is taken respectively, placed in a clean container, sealed, and placed in a constant temperature box, and stored under the conditions of 25℃, relative humidity 60%, 30℃, relative humidity 60%, 35℃, relative humidity 50%, and 40℃, relative humidity 50%, and the content of phenylephrine hydrochloride is checked at different times.
[0106]
[0107] Conclusion: The degradation rates of Examples 1 to 3 are low after 3 months and 6 months of stability test, which shows that the effervescent granules prepared by the present application have strong stability.
